What Are Pipe Fittings?
Pipe fittings are mechanical accessories that are employed to facilitate the establishment, withdrawal, or redirection of pathways in a plumbing/piping system. These accessories come with differing size and shape specifications to fit an array of materials and applications available. The primary purpose of the pipe fittings is to ensure that pipe segments are connected in a secure and leak-proof molecular manner so that the hazardous liquid of all sorts like water, oil, gases, and steam are safely transported.
Types of Pipe Fittings
Pipe fittings can be identified according to their shape, design, and the method of manufacture. Here are the most common categories:
1. By Shape
Elbows: These are parts that are applied to redirect pipes and are generally available in two different angles of either 90 or 45 degrees.
Tees: Branch off from the main line and connect three pipes at a 90-degree angle
Reducers: These fittings join pipes of diverse diameters and hence enable a smooth switching between sizes.
Caps and Plugs: These fittings close up the ends of the pipes and so keep the fluid from passing through when needed.
Unions: Provide a quick disconnect option that enables easy maintenance and assembly.
2. By Manufacturing Process
Malleable Iron Fittings: Being one of the most durable in the market, these fittings are a favorite choice in the high-pressure applications besides their heftiness. Black and galvanized are the two finishes that are both available. They are used mostly in the construction of pipelines.
Galvanized pipe fittings: A layer of zinc will be applied to these components which will give them some protection against outdoor and wet environments, as well as rust and corrosion. The coating of zinc is responsible for the rust-proof and non-corrosion properties of these fittings.
Stainless Steel Fittings: Highly corrosion-resistant and capable of staying clean and hygienic, stainless steel fittings are the right choice for those working in the food and pharmaceutical sectors.

Measuring Pipe Fittings: NPT and BSPT
Knowing how to measure pipe fittings is the key to ensuring compatibility and correct installation. The two thread standards that are most commonly used are the NPT (National Pipe Taper) and BSPT (British Standard Pipe Taper).
NPT Threaded Fittings
NPT fittings with their design of tapered threads will effectively create a seal once these are picked up and assembled. The taper is such that the connection is made so tightly that there will be no leaks. They are also known as NPT fittings as they are widely applied in the United States for gas lines and plumbing.
BSPT Threaded Fittings
The taper on the threads of a BSPT fitting is 55 degrees and it is absolutely effective in sealing the fitting, thus the joint can fit any network of pipes. BSPT fittings are widely used in Europe and in the Commonwealth of Nations. The standard dimensions enable easy replacement of one BSPT-fitting with another that is BSPT-compliant.
